SUBJECT : THE DEPARTMENT OF WELFARE WELCOMES THE SENTENCING OF PATRICK SIMPIWE NGQINA.

The Eastern Cape Welfare Department welcomes the 22-year jail term imposed on Simphiwe Ngqina for the cold blooded murder of our official 
the late Mabhoyz Ntsikelelo Zixesha at Ngcingwana village in Idutywa in June this year.

We take comfort to the outcome of the case because we strongly feel that it has been dealt with speedily and over and above that, justice 
has finally been done.

However, it is hoped that the justice system will as well leave no stone unturned in its investigations thereby unmasking the conspirators 
to this matter so that the due process of law takes it course.

In the same vein, we take our caps off to the members of the public who helped the police to track down these killers. Their actions are 
indeed encouraging in the spirit of constructive partnerships with government.

To the investigating team, this is a job well-done and a giant step in the realisation of the National Crime Prevention Strategy.

Lastly, we call on all our people individually and through their structures to close ranks and help the Department in particular and the 
Provincial government in general to fighting fraud and corruption and other irregularities in our social security database.
